A few updates today regarding work done outside the Harry Potter films by the trio of Emma Watson (Hermione), Rupert Grint (Ron) and Dan Radcliffe (Harry).
First as a follow to what we first told you last month: The dinner plate that Emma Watson designed for charity is now up for auction. Bidding is going well for the dinner plate (seen here) which is part of the Blue Peter Mission Nutrition campaign to help fight world hunger. The auction runs until February 7th.
Tickets for Cherrybomb, the new film starring Rupert Grint which is premiering this month at the Berlin Film Festival went on sale this morning. Equus, the play starring actors Dan Radcliffe and Richard Griffiths (Uncle Vernon) is due to come to an end this month on Broadway. As such, the famed restaraunt Sardis has added a caricature of Dan Radcliffe to the walls of their legendary building in New York, joining the hundreds of famed actors and actresses who have graced the boards of the theater over the years. The final performance of Dan and Richard in Equus will be on February 8th.
